What Are Accident Injury Damages?
Accident injury damages can be categorized into numerous types, primarily divided into 2 primary classes: compensatory damages and compensatory damages.
Countervailing Damages
Offsetting damages are created to reimburse the victim for losses incurred due to an accident. These can be additional divided into two subcategories:

Economic Damages: These damages are measurable, straight linked to the monetary loss experienced due to the accident. Examples include:
Medical Expenses: Costs for emergency situation care, hospital stays, rehab, and any needed medical equipment.Lost Wages: Compensation for income lost due to time far from work.Property Damage: The expense of repairing or replacing damaged property, such as an automobile.
Non-Economic Damages: These are subjective and cover intangible losses that do not have a direct financial value. Examples consist of:
Pain and Suffering: Compensation for physical pain and psychological distress related to the injury.Loss of Enjoyment of Life: Compensation for unfavorable influence on the victim's capability to delight in life activities.Emotional Distress: Compensation for mental impacts coming from the Accident Injury Attorney.Compensatory damages
Unlike countervailing damages, punitive damages are not awarded to repay victims but are intended to punish the offender for particularly reckless or destructive behavior and hinder similar actions in the future. Punitive damages are fairly unusual and are typically evaluated in cases of gross negligence or deliberate misbehavior.

The computation of accident injury damages can be detailed, as it requires an assessment of both tangible and intangible losses.

Economic Damages Calculation:
Gathering Documentation: Collect bills, pay stubs, and repair work quotes to corroborate claims for medical costs and lost earnings.Future Lost Earnings: In some cases, it might be suitable to determine future profits if the injury impacts a victim's capacity to work long-lasting.Residential or commercial property Repairs: Obtain estimates or invoices for fixing or replacing damaged property.
Non-Economic Damages Calculation:
Pain and Suffering: This can be computed utilizing different techniques, including the multiplier approach (where overall financial damages are multiplied by an aspect generally between 1.5 to 5) or the per diem method (assigning a daily rate for discomfort and suffering).Loss of Enjoyment of Life: Victims may supply proof of how their lifestyle has actually altered, such as statements from friends and family.Table 2: Calculation Methods for DamagesDamage TypeEstimation MethodDescriptionEconomic DamagesDocument-BasedOverall expenses and losses are calculated with receipts and pay stubsNon-Economic DamagesMultiplier MethodTotal financial damages increased by a multiplierDaily MethodAssigning a daily value to pain and suffering based on the duration of distressAspects Influencing Accident Injury Damages
Numerous aspects can influence the quantity of damages granted in accident cases:

Severity of the Injury: More serious injuries may lead to greater medical bills and longer recovery times, increasing financial and non-economic damages.

Effect on Life: The degree to which the Brain Injury Legal Team affects the victim's ability to work, take part in day-to-day activities, and take pleasure in life plays a considerable function in the compensation quantity.

Period of Treatment: If long-lasting treatment or rehab is necessary, damages might increase appropriately.

State Laws: Different states have differing laws concerning damage caps, contributing negligence, Pedestrian Injury Attorney and statutes of constraints, all of which can influence damage awards.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What is the statute of restrictions on submitting a personal injury claim?A1: The statute of constraints differs by state. Normally, it ranges from one to six years from the date of the accident. It is vital to talk to a personal Brain Injury Legal Team attorney in your state for specific deadlines.

Q2: Can I get compensation if I was partially at fault?A2: Yes, most states
follow a comparative negligence rule, implying you can still recover damages even if you were partly accountable for the accident. However, your compensation may be lowered based upon the portion of your fault.

Q3: Are punitive damages insurance-covered?
A3: Typically, punitive damages are not covered by insurance plan. This suggests the accused might require to pay out-of-pocket if granted punitive damages.

Q4: How long does it require to settle an injury claim?A4: The timeline for
settling an accident claim can vary widely depending upon the complexity of the case, the intensity of injuries, and the willingness of the parties to negotiate. It can take anywhere from a couple of months to numerous years.
